Cognitive development in early childhood is crucial, especially when it comes to foundational skills like addition and subtraction. Word problems introduce young learners, ages 4-8, to practical applications of mathematical concepts, promoting critical thinking and comprehension. They encourage children to process and analyze information, helping to foster problem-solving abilities essential for lifelong learning.
Additionally, solving word problems cultivates language skills as children learn to interpret and describe various scenarios mathematically. This process enhances their vocabulary and encourages them to articulate their reasoning, making connections between written language and numerical concepts.
Furthermore, engaging in word problems can build a child's confidence in math. As they successfully navigate these challenges, they develop perseverance and a growth mindset, key traits for academic resilience.
For parents and teachers, understanding the importance of these exercises means they can support and guide children effectively, creating enriching learning environments. Encouraging young learners to tackle real-world scenarios through word problems not only hones their mathematical skills but also prepares them for more complex concepts in future education. Ultimately, nurturing cognitive development in this way lays a strong foundation for both academic success and everyday life skills.
